Affected integrations return error QB-SCAN-17 and drop the session. Disable batching in your plugin manifest until Quillmark ships the 4.2 patch. Plugins using the legacy serial adapter are not affected. Do not retry handshakes more than three times; repeated failures lock the device queue for ten minutes. If your plugin is impacted, report the scanner model and firmware to the integrations desk.

escalation mailbox, hadug-bajog: sormir@norvalabs.internal

Use zstd level 3; gzip is deprecated as of release 4.2. Batch payloads to 256 KB max, uncompressed. Oversized batches get a 413 and are dropped, not queued. The ingest endpoint validates the content-encoding header strictly — mismatches count against your error budget. Dashboards for compression ratios live under the Quillgate ops board. Staging credentials rotate monthly; production quarterly. For the staging ingest service, authenticate with the key below.

app token of yajeg-kawef = kto11_7En3XSX8xQw

Quarterly Planning Note — Divestiture of the Coastal Tooling Unit

For the finance team: the sale of the Coastal Tooling unit to Pellmark Industries remains on track for close in Q3. Please finalize the carve-out balance sheet, reconcile intercompany positions, and prepare the working-capital adjustment schedule by month-end. Audit support requests should be prioritized. For planning purposes, note the following sensitive item:

internal memo for hawef-kahif: The finance team signed off on a budget of $25.9 million for Project Sorox. The renewal with Pelokek Logistics closes at $51.7 million a year, 52 percent below the last contract.

## Authentication

Heads up: the nightly reindex job (`reindex_nightly.py`) talks to the Lanternfish search cluster, and that cluster won't accept anonymous writes anymore — we locked it down last sprint. The job now authenticates as the `reindex-runner` service identity against Corvid Gateway, and the token is injected via the `LF_INDEX_TOKEN` env var in the scheduler config. Nothing clever going on, just a bearer header on every batch request. For review purposes, the staging credential currently in use is listed below.

service key, kadug-kadup: kto15_rN23XLAYImmZgrJ